I wasn't going in expecting much, but the game is fantastic. I have cleared the story, and played a few rounds of co-op. It has a lot of variety, some silly bits, and just a lot of fun frenetic action.
It is the most fun I have had in a single player FPS game in a very long time. Even trumping Wolfenstein, a game I have raved about. Probably the best marquee title released this year. Unless you play last gen, then it is an ugly mess with unrefined controls. But PS4? It is gorgeous and plays like a dream. The graphics reach "um, is that FMV" standards a few times. This is the game that can really show why we went from last gen to current.
After a year of the big releases being disappointing, have a game I had low exceptions for exceed them to a great degree was a wonderful thing.

The campaign isn't the best that the franchise has done (I loved both Black Ops campaigns and even MW2's) but it's at least EONS better than Ghosts. It's short and the story has been done in better video games even, but it's fun and full of the moments that make COD like a blockbuster action movie. And the MP this year is a definite step up. It's actually fun and the exo suits definitely make for some great dogfights. Sure, you can draw comparisons, but seriously...I don't think we can go back to doing single jumps in FPS's again.

The story isn't the best, but it is told way better. You have at least some reason to care about your character because he is actually part of the story and not a faceless drone/brother who never talks. But the levels have more ambiance and slow moments. They have less big action moments and more time to reflect on them. Everything is just paced out better. The only real issue is it is a fairly standard plot. The level design and enemy encounters are better too. SO while it may not have the best story, I will stand up and say it has the best story mode.
